The History and Significance of 'Jesus Loves Me'

The hymn 'Jesus Loves Me' is one of the most recognizable and beloved Christian songs of all time. With its simple yet powerful melody and lyrics, it has become a staple of Sunday school classes, church services, and family devotionals. The song's message of God's unconditional love and acceptance has resonated with people of all ages and backgrounds, making it a timeless classic.

The song was written in 1860 by Anna Warner, an American writer and teacher, and was originally titled 'Jesus Loves Me, This I Know'. It was intended to be a children's song, but its message and melody quickly made it a favorite among adults as well. Over the years, 'Jesus Loves Me' has been translated into numerous languages and has been recorded by countless artists, making it one of the most widely known and loved Christian hymns in the world.
